The Role of Trinity House
A Corporation of Five Centuries
The Corporation of Trinity House of Deptford Strond was incorporated by a charter of Henry VIII in 1514, making it one of the oldest continuously operating maritime organisations in the world. Its name derives from the guild of mariners that preceded it — the Brotherhood of the Most Glorious and Undivided Trinity and of St Clement — which had existed in some form since at least the fifteenth century, centred on the Thames riverside town of Deptford. Henry's charter gave the Brotherhood formal legal status and the authority to regulate pilotage on the Thames. Subsequent charters extended that authority progressively until Trinity House became, and remains, the General Lighthouse Authority for England, Wales and the Channel Islands, as well as the competent authority for deep-sea pilotage in the approaches to UK ports.
The organisation's character is unusual in British public life: it is neither a government department nor a purely private body, but a self-governing corporation of Elder and Younger Brethren, the Elder Brethren being the active governing members. The Master is traditionally a senior public figure, and the roll of past Masters includes Samuel Pepys, who served in the 1670s and whose diary is one of the richest accounts of seventeenth-century maritime London. Today the board of Elder Brethren includes serving and former naval officers, merchant mariners and engineers. The organisation is funded by light dues — a levy on commercial shipping using UK ports, calculated on the vessels' tonnage — rather than from general taxation.
What Trinity House Does
Trinity House's primary statutory function is to provide and maintain lighthouses, light vessels, buoys, beacons and other aids to navigation on the English and Welsh coast and in the Channel Islands. At the most basic level, this means ensuring that a comprehensive network of lights and marks exists to guide vessels safely around the coastline and into ports, and that those lights and marks function reliably.
The operational estate at the time of writing comprises 66 lighthouses, 11 light vessels and floating aids, and some 430 buoys and other marks. Each lighthouse is monitored remotely from Trinity House's operations centre at Harwich in Essex, which receives status transmissions from every station at regular intervals. Any fault — a lamp failure, a rotation stoppage, a fog signal malfunction — triggers an alert and a maintenance deployment. Response teams operate from depots at Harwich and elsewhere, reaching coastal stations by road and offshore stations by the Corporation's depot vessels or by contracted helicopter services.
Beyond the physical estate, Trinity House operates as a competent authority for the licensing of deep-sea pilots — a specialised professional category whose practitioners board large vessels in the approaches to UK ports and guide them through confined or hazardous waters. Trinity House pilotage areas include the Thames Estuary, where the approach channel through the sandbanks of the estuary mouth requires specialist knowledge, and several other major port approaches. Port pilotage (within port limits) is managed by the port authorities themselves, but the qualifying standards and licences for the outer approaches remain a Trinity House responsibility.
The Lighthouse Estate: Selected Stations
The diversity of Trinity House's lighthouse estate reflects the variety of the English and Welsh coast. The Eddystone, 22 kilometres south of Plymouth, is the Corporation's most famous station — a 49-metre granite tower on a wave-washed reef, built by James Douglas in 1882, automated in 1982, and maintained as an active aid to navigation flashing two white flashes every ten seconds with a range of 20 nautical miles. At the other extreme, the modest harbour lights at ports like Ramsgate and Whitby are equally within the Corporation's remit.
The Needles Lighthouse, at the western tip of the Isle of Wight, marks one of the most visible hazards in the Channel approaches. Built in 1859 on the outermost of the chalk stacks from which the group takes its name, the tower is 33 metres tall and exhibits a flashing red, white and green sector light visible for 17 nautical miles. The red sector covers the Shingles bank to the north; the white sector the safe fairway; the green sector the Warden Shoal to the south. This use of coloured sectors to indicate specific dangers rather than simply marking a general area is characteristic of Trinity House design practice.
South Bishop, on a low rocky island 7 kilometres west of the Pembrokeshire coast, marks the southern approach to St George's Channel and the Irish Sea. Built in 1839 to designs by James Walker, the tower is 36 metres tall and exhibits a white flash every five seconds, range 16 nautical miles. It was automated in 1983. The station's meteorological records, maintained by Trinity House keepers from 1839 until automation, contribute to the long-run climate datasets that researchers use to study Atlantic weather patterns.
The Light Vessel Fleet
In positions where lighthouse construction is impractical — over soft sediment, in deep water, or where the navigational mark needs to be repositioned as channels shift — Trinity House deploys light vessels and large navigational buoys. The light vessel tradition in England dates from the eighteenth century, when the first purpose-built floating lighthouses were anchored in the Thames Estuary approaches. The Nore Light Vessel, established in 1732, is generally credited as the world's first light vessel.
Modern Trinity House light vessels are large ships typically around 55 metres in length, with powerful lanterns on a central mast and automatic fog signal equipment. They are positioned by GPS anchor systems and relay their position and status data to Harwich continuously. The East Goodwin light vessel, off the Goodwin Sands in the Strait of Dover, marks one of the most densely trafficked stretches of water in the world — the Dover Strait handles approximately 500 commercial vessel transits per day. The Goodwins themselves are a notorious shoal of shifting sand that has claimed several hundred vessels since medieval times.
Marking and Buoyage
The buoyage system around the English and Welsh coast, maintained largely by Trinity House with contributions from harbour authorities, follows the International Association of Lighthouse Authorities (IALA) Maritime Buoyage System Region A. This standardises the colour, shape, topmark and light character of lateral marks (those defining the sides of a navigable channel), cardinal marks (those indicating the position of a hazard relative to the compass), and special marks. Port-hand marks are red; starboard-hand marks are green, following the European convention. The US and some other regions follow IALA Region B, where the colour assignments are reversed — a difference that catches out navigators who transit between the two zones.
Trinity House reviews the buoyage system continuously, revising the position and character of marks as dredging, silting and changes in traffic patterns alter the navigable channels. The frequency of revision in the Thames Estuary alone, where the complex sandbank topography shifts seasonally, requires several amendments to the buoyage plan each year.
Heritage and Public Engagement
Trinity House maintains a significant collection of lighthouse artefacts, including removed Fresnel lenses, historic lanterns, and documentary archives relating to the Corporation's five centuries of operation. The Elder Brethren Hall in Trinity Square in the City of London is one of the Corporation's historic properties, though the main operational headquarters have been at Harwich since the twentieth century. The organisation participates in International Lighthouse Heritage Weekend — the annual event, held in August, when many lighthouses worldwide open to visitors — and manages public access to a small number of its operational stations.
The Corporation's archive at Guildhall Library and the National Archives contains records from the sixteenth century to the present, including keepers' logs, engineering drawings, accident reports, and the administrative correspondence of the lighthouse authority through every major period of maritime history. These records are an important resource for maritime, social and engineering historians.

The Wider System
Trinity House is one of three General Lighthouse Authorities in the United Kingdom and Ireland. The Northern Lighthouse Board performs the equivalent function for Scotland and the Isle of Man; the Commissioners of Irish Lights for the Republic of Ireland and Northern Ireland. The three bodies operate independently but coordinate through a joint committee and share standards, procurement and, in some cases, vessels. The light dues that fund all three are collected centrally and distributed among them in proportion to their costs. The combined estate of the three organisations represents one of the most comprehensive systems of maritime aids to navigation in the world.
